Action item (INC-227): Flaky DNS in the Harrowdale zone caused intermittent resolution failures for the Pinebarrel API. Root cause: stale resolver cache after the Thistlegate nameserver swap. Mitigation shipped: lowered TTLs, added a second resolver pool. On-call: if NXDOMAIN spikes recur, flush the resolver cache on the edge nodes and verify both pools answer. Do not restart the API itself. Full remediation steps are documented on the internal page here.

operations page: https://jenkins.zemvarcloud.local/job/merge_requests/repo/build/73930b4b30f0a8ed

## Configuration

Picklot (our warehouse pick-list optimizer) reads everything from `.env`, so no YAML spelunking needed. `PICKLOT_ZONE_MAP` points at the aisle layout, and `PICKLOT_BATCH_SIZE` caps how many orders get bundled per runner. Defaults are sane for the Brindleford site. The optimizer also calls the routing service on every recompute, and that call needs an auth token, which lives on the next line.

vault entry, fafop-badup: VAULT_KEY5=2cf8b

## Provenance: Feedwarden Podcast Validator

For security review: every Feedwarden release is built in an isolated runner, and the resulting artifact is signed against the exact commit, dependency lockfile, and builder image digest. No manually uploaded binaries are ever deployed. Reviewers should confirm the signature chain before approving promotion. The currently deployed build carries the token shown below.

session token of tajef-bageg = htk21_5d90d574934f3ccae6437

MEMO — Sales Leads, Kestrun Dynamics

Effective immediately: discounts above 15% on deals over 500 seats require sign-off from Regional VP. No stacking promotional and volume discounts. Multi-year terms may add 5% max. Exceptions go through Deal Desk, 48-hour turnaround. Non-compliant quotes will be voided. Rationale and forward strategy are set out in the confidential note below.

internal memo for kawip-hadug: Headcount on the Wenwyn team goes from 7 to 140 by the end of January. Gross margin on Wenwyn came in at 20 percent against a plan of 15 percent.